What this tells you
- Holds 38,400 IPv4 addresses and 34,360,000,517 IPv6 /64 networks across 152 registered blocks.
- Announced by 6 networks, the largest being AS5538 Institute of Mathematics and Computer Science of University of Latvia at 57% of the IPv4 space.
- All of the space we can place resolves to Latvia.
